I'm hoping to go to spain for the winter and to help with the massive fuel bill to get my RV there someone suggested taking a load of english goodies to sell, maybe on a market stall there. The likes of HP suace, marmite, buscuits etc.
I'm wondering if anyones done this before ? what is the score with import tax etc ??

Depending on where you are planning on going in Spain you will find that most of the English items mentioned can now be bought in the larger spanish supermarkets. There are also many English type shops in the Benidorm/Campello area so not sure how big the market would be for your products, unless of course they were alot cheaper than the shops already there.

First you can not sale food in a market over here some do I know but if court you have big probs
2nd So many shops here now have it all and some cheaper than the U.K also there are many cash and carry here now.But If you want to try then make sure that what ever you bring has the contents in Spanish Good luck.:roflmto:

I see it so many times over here, and help a few campers out, they dont plan for a trip just put a few things in the van and of they go. Your friends will tell you that here to scrap a van cost money Any van with a Uk plate here now is not worth much many brits that come over here in there car and stay for years driving with uk plates are in for a shock now you cant tax a uk plated car here so the police are now starting to pull them in.

Buy for a pound and sale for 2 i dont think so, Please I am not trying to put you down but what you want to do here is not that easy, There is tax to pay unless you are going to ask for what is called black money then you will find you only get about half what others get. Also now more police go in to bars and ask for papers to see if your paying tax here,some get away with it some dont .The other thing is were are you going to park. Please think this through if you go for it good luck. When you get here and if i can help in anyway just let me know.
